Hands-on learning! School spirit! Sisterhood!
While on our campus for this event, eighth graders will:
- Become a student in a STEM, humanities, and art class at Notre Dame.
- Experience a school spirit rally hosted by the sophomore class for the eighth graders — the Class of 2028 (blue and green sharks) will become the 'big sister class' to the incoming Class of 2030.
- Witness how fun memories, sisterhood, and leadership are part of the Notre Dame experience!
